South actor charged Rs 21 crore for Shahrukh’s film Jawan, rejected 2 action films

Fans are eagerly waiting for Bollywood actor Shahrukh Khan’s action film ‘Jawan’. Tamil superstar Vijay Sethupathi is going to be seen in the negative role in the film. According to media reports, Vijay has charged a hefty amount for working in this film.

Vijay is taking huge amount for the film

It is being told in media reports that Vijay has taken a fee of Rs 21 crore for working in this film. Earlier, Vijay had taken 15 crores for his last film. It is being said that Vijay has charged the highest fee till date in ‘Jawan’.

Vijay rejected the offer of 2 films because of ‘Jawan’

Along with this, it is also being said that Vijay has also rejected the offer of 2 action films for this film. Sources say that Vijay’s character in the film ‘Jawan’ is so powerful, that he did not face any problem in skipping other films.

The film will be released in 5 languages ​​including Hindi

‘Jawan’ is written and directed by Atlee. Apart from Hindi, it will be released in five languages ​​including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am and Kannada. The film is being produced under the banner of Shahrukh Khan’s production house ‘Red Chillies Entertainment’. ‘Jawaan’ will be released in theaters on June 2, 2023. Apart from Shahrukh Khan and Vijay, Nayantara and Sanya Malhotra will also be in lead roles in this film.
